how many positive integers are between 28/3 and 83/5

Answers

There are 7 positive integers in between 28/3 and 83/5.

What is an integer?

An integer is a whole number (not a fractional number) that can be positive, negative or zero.

Given that;

Two fractions are;

28/3 and 83/5.

Now, Write fraction into decimal form as;

28/3 = 9.33

83/5 = 16.6

So, All Integers in between 9.33 and 16.6 are;

⇒ 10, 11, 12, 13, 14, 15, 16

Thus, There are 7 positive integers in between 28/3 and 83/5.

the length of a rectagle is 5 in longer than its width. if the perimeter of the rectangle is 56 in, find its length and width

Answers

Answer:

Step-by-step explanation:

Let the width of the rectangle = x

As length is 5 inches longer than width, we have to add 5 to width

Length = x + 5

Perimeter of ractangle = 56 in

2* (length + width) = 56

2*( x + 5 + x) = 56

2* (2x + 5)    = 56

Use distributive property: a*(b +c) =(a*b) + (a * c)

2*2x + 2*5   = 56

4x  + 10 = 56

Subtract 10 from both sides

4x = 56- 10

4x = 46

Divide both sides by 4

x = 46/4

x = 11.5

Width = 11.5 in

length = 11.5 + 5

            = 16.5 in

Solve | x + 6| - 7 = 8

A: x= -9 and x = -21

B: x = 9 and x = -9

C: x = -9 and x = 21

D: x = 9 and x = -21

Answers

Answer:

x = 9,-21

Step-by-step explanation:

Given:

[tex]\displaystyle \large{|x+6|-7=8}[/tex]

Transport -7 to add 8:

[tex]\displaystyle \large{|x+6|=8+7}\\\displaystyle \large{|x+6|=15}[/tex]

Cancel absolute sign and add plus-minus to 15:

[tex]\displaystyle \large{x+6=\pm 15}[/tex]

Transport 6 to subtract ±15:

[tex]\displaystyle \large{x=\pm 15-6}[/tex]

Consider:

[tex]\displaystyle \large{x= 15-6}[/tex] or [tex]\displaystyle \large{x = -15-6}[/tex]

[tex]\displaystyle \large{x=9}[/tex] or [tex]\displaystyle \large{x=-21}[/tex]

Solution:

[tex]\displaystyle \large{x = 9}[/tex] or [tex]\displaystyle \large{x=-21}[/tex]
